What are Mini Dental Implants?

Mini Dental Implants in Buffalo, NY Implant Dentist Todd Shatkin DDSMini dental implant treatment combines the benefits of dentures with the benefits of implants. Dentures have always been a low-cost way to replace lost teeth, but they can be uncomfortable and, because they are removable, can slip or fall out when chewing or talking. This can be embarrassing and often leave people feeling uncomfortable in social situations. A mini dental implant can provide permanent replacement teeth that are strong and durable, but the cost is often higher than people can afford. This is where mini dental implants solve the problem.

Traditional implants are surgically put into the jawbone and are designed to have a replacement screwed onto the post. They require strong bone mass in the jaw in order to support the replacement teeth. Unfortunately, not everyone has the bone mass that is required for full implants. The good news is that a mini dental implant does not require the same level of bone mass but can still provide the security of stabilized replacement teeth.

See also  Our New iSmile Teeth Whitening Spa

Mini dental implants are smaller in size and, instead of a screw thread, they have a small ball on the end that comes through the gum. Dentures are then designed to pop onto these posts and are secured into place with O-rings. These posts keep your dentures secure and in place when you are wearing them, but easy to remove when cleaning is necessary. While mini dental implant treatment can be used in the upper jaw, they are typically used more for lower dentures. How are Mini Dental Implants Placed?

Similar to traditional implant placement, a small incision is made into the gum and a hole is drilled into the jawbone. The mini dental implant posts are placed into the bone and the dentist sutures the gums closed. Mini dental implant placement is slightly less invasive than traditional implants and requires no time to heal without your dentures in place. Once the procedure is complete, your dentures can be put into place immediately. While you may experience some discomfort for a few days, you should be able to resume normal activity immediately.

Securing and Removing Your Dentures

Securing your dentures into place with mini dental implants is quick and easy. Simply hold your denture on each outer side and gently place the denture on top of the posts. Ensure that the O-rings are positioned over the posts. With light pressure, snap the denture down into place.

To remove your dentures for cleaning, simply put each thumb underneath each side of the denture and gently push up, freeing them from the post. Use care to apply pressure equally to both sides.

How Do You Care For Your Dental Implants?

Caring for your mini dental implant begins with traditional denture cleaning. Remove and clean your dentures as instructed by your dentist. In addition to cleaning your dentures, you must clean and take care of the implants. Brushing the posts, as you would natural teeth, helps remove plaque and bacteria that can build up. Make sure to thoroughly clean and brush both the ball of each implant and around the O-rings. Keeping these areas clean helps to ensure your dentures will sit properly and stay in place.

If you already have dentures, you may be able to use them with mini dental implant treatment. In many cases, your current dentures can be retrofitted to fit the implants and save on costs.
